A Course in Miracles is allegedly a 'new revelation' from 'Jesus' to help humanity work through these troubled times. This 'Jesus', who bears no doctrinal resemblance to the Bible's Jesus Christ, began delivering channeled teachings in 1965 to a Columbia University
Professor of Medical Psychology, Helen Schucman.

One day Schucman heard an 'inner voice' stating, 'This is a course in miracles. Please take notes.' For seven years she diligently
took spiritual dictation from this voice that described himself as 'Jesus.'
